Valerie “Val” J. (Fryer) Dodge, 64 of Plainfield, NH died October 13, 2025 after a courageous year-long battle with glioblastoma.She was born in Augusta, ME on June 6, 1961, a daughter of Sally M. (Card) Fryer of Merrimack and the late Joseph N. Morin.  She passed quietly at...
